We’re looking for an experienced Senior Quantity Surveyor to join a growing project team and take commercial ownership of some of the company’s larger and higher-risk projects.

This is a senior, hands-on position where you’ll work closely with Project Managers, Engineers, clients and the supply chain, providing strong commercial leadership while helping shape and improve commercial processes across the business.

Key Responsibilities

  • Take full commercial responsibility for assigned projects.
  • Manage valuations, variations, change control, compensation events and final accounts.
  • Lead cost control, forecasting, CVRs and cashflow management.
  • Identify and manage commercial and contractual risks and opportunities.
  • Procure and manage subcontractor and supply chain packages.
  • Assess subcontractor applications, variations and final accounts.
  • Provide contractual and commercial advice to Project Managers and delivery teams.
  • Support extensions of time, loss & expense, compensation events and dispute resolution where required.
  • Ensure strong commercial governance, record keeping and contractual compliance.
  • Provide clear and accurate commercial reporting to senior management.
  • Mentor and support Project Managers, Engineers and junior commercial staff.
  • Contribute to improving commercial systems, processes and reporting across the business. What We're Looking For
  • Significant experience in Quantity Surveying or a senior commercial role.
  • Background in construction, M&E, engineering or multidisciplinary projects.
  • Strong knowledge of JCT and/or NEC contracts.
  • Proven experience managing valuations, variations, change control and final accounts.
  • Strong subcontract procurement and supply chain management experience.
  • Confident with forecasting, CVRs, cost control and cashflow.
  • Excellent negotiation, communication and stakeholder management skills.
  • Degree, HNC/HND or equivalent in Quantity Surveying, Commercial Management or a related discipline.
  • MRICS / MCIOB or working towards professional accreditation is desirable.
  • Strong Microsoft Excel and Microsoft Office skills.
